This Wednesday morning in Phoenix, Arizona, an car accident with a man on a bicycle occured, killing the cyclist.
Phoenix Police Department informed that crash took place in the south Phoenix area, at the intersection of 19th Avenue and Broadway road.
Phoenix police spokesman, Officer James Holmes, stated that the man who was hit has been identified as 20-year-old Luis Edwardo Santall.
He went on to say that Santalla had been heading westbound, crossing in the crosswalk on Broadway Road, when a Salt River Project truck hit him while the vehicle was turning south on 19th Avenue.
Holmes reported that the driver did in fact stop, and that impairment is not suspected to be a factor in this instance. It was reported that the driver was being cooperative.
It is unclear if the truck driver will be cited for his involvement in the collision.
The cause of the crash is not clearly known at this time, and the investigation is ongoing.
